deryk, I did customize the unit. I painted, detailed per protoytpe photos. i changed out the motor, driveshafts, and worm gears with new ones from an athearn ready to run ac4400/c44-9w to improve running. I added the dcc adapter board, and hooked all the lights to the board. i also have the 777, and 767 units also.
